The assessee is an agriculturalist and the rural agricultural land of the assessee was acquired by the Haryana State Industrial & Infrastructure Development Corporation Ltd. (HSIIDC) under section 4 of the Land Acquisition Act, 1894 for developing industrial area in Manesar, Gurgaon. Since, HSIIDC had not paid the compensation at the prevailing market rate, the assessee had approached the Ld. Authorised Representative submitted that the assessees had, before the lower authorities, placed reliance on the judgment of the Hon'ble Apex Court in the case of CIT vs. Ghanshyam (HUF) reported in 315 ITR 1 (SC) wherein the Hon'ble Apex Court had held that the interest allowed on compensation was part of the total compensation and was, therefore, exempt from levy of Income Tax.
